Portsmouth - Saltwater Fishing Report

End of the season

With the cold weather approaching and the fishing slowing down it appeared that Oct. 14th would be a good day to pull the Reel Ecstasy out of the water and get it ready for the winter months.

We had a great season though, and I thank all of my customers for the wonderful times we spent together.

Fishing was excellent this year from Mid May right through Sept. 30th.

Cold fronts and storms turned the fish off in Oct. and we went from a 30 fish day on Sept. 30 to a 3 fish day on Oct. 4th. The next few weekends the weather just wasn't good enough to go out and I decided it was time to call it quits for the year.

I still will do a little Freshwater Bass fishing on my little boat till the end of October which is usually a great time for smallmouth bass.
